Print Rights – Under the Microsoft® Bing™ Maps Platform APIs’ Terms of Use
The following print rights terms (“Print Rights Terms”) form a part of the Microsoft Bing Maps Platform APIs' Terms of Use (“TOU”) between you and Microsoft. Your use herein must also be consistent with the TOU. All capitalized terms not otherwise defined in these Print Rights Terms or in the SDKs will have the meaning ascribed to those terms in the TOU. You and your end users may print, save or use screen shots of the Content of the type “Road Map”, “Aerial”, and “Streetside” in accordance with the SDKs and these Print Rights Terms (“Prints”).
-
1. General Rights and Restrictions for Prints with a Bing Maps License and Volume License of the TOU. If you have separately entered into an Agreement, additional rights may also apply to your use of Prints. In the event of any conflict between these Print Rights Terms and your Agreement, your Agreement shall prevail. - 1.1. Commercial Purposes. Your Prints may be used for commercial purposes. Acceptable commercial purposes for Prints include: (i) use in an advertisement or press article about Company products or services; (ii) sending PDF Prints to customers; (iii) printing a browser page with Content to create a flyer or handout; (iv) use within documents or presentations; and (v) sending in an email.
- 1.2. Attribution Requirements. Prints must include the copyright notices from the Services and Content, including, without limitation, any logo, trademark, copyright or other notice of Microsoft or its suppliers and digital watermarks. You must ensure that the copyright notices are not removed, minimized, blocked, modified or obscured in any Prints. You must include the following copyright attribution statement: "Microsoft product screen shot(s) reprinted with permission from Microsoft Corporation. If your use includes references to a Microsoft product, you must use the full name of the product. When referencing any Microsoft trademarks, you must follow the General Microsoft Trademark Guidelines.
-
1.3 Restrictions. We do have some restrictions on your use of Prints with your Application through the Services. You may not, nor may you permit your end users to:
- (a) Use Prints in a way that is disparaging, defamatory, or libelous to Microsoft, any of its products, or any other person or entity.
- (b) Use Prints of an identifiable individual.
- (c) Make more than 5,000 copies of any single Road Map Print or Aerial Print.
- (d) Access, download, transmit or save the 'raw' data (tiles) from the Services under any circumstances.
- (e) Use Prints of type "Ordnance Survey Map" as described in the SDK's.
- (f) Use Prints to create production maps which are similar to or compete with commercial maps or atlases.
- (g) Use the Services to produce Prints similar to a local mapping authority.
- (h) Directly or indirectly imply Microsoft sponsorship, affiliation, or endorsement of your product or service.
- (i) Use Prints in a comparative advertisement.
- (j) Alter a screen shot in any way except to resize the screen shot.
- (k) Include Prints in your product user interface.
- (l) Make prints that display the Zenrin copyright notice, © [Year] Zenrin. For example, maps isolated solely on Japan.

2. General Rights and Restrictions for Prints under Section 5 (Education or Non-Profit Organization use), Section 6 (Limited Public Website Use), Section 9 (Mobile App Development), or Section 10 (Windows App Development) of the TOU.
- 2.1. Non-Commercial and Personal Purposes Only. Prints may only be used for your personal and non-commercial use.
- 2.2. Attribution Requirements. Prints must include the copyright notices from the Services and Content, including, without limitation, any logo, trademark, copyright or other notice of Microsoft or its suppliers and digital watermarks. You must ensure that the copyright notices are not removed, minimized, blocked, modified or obscured in any Prints. When referencing any Microsoft trademarks, you must follow the General Microsoft Trademark Guidelines.
-
2.3 Restrictions. We do have some restrictions on your use of Prints with your Application through the Services. You may not, nor may you permit your end users to:
- (a) Use Prints in a way that is disparaging, defamatory, or libelous to Microsoft, any of its products, or any other person or entity.
- (b) Use Prints of an identifiable individual.
- (c) Make more than 10 copies of any single Road Map or Aerial Print.
- (d) Access, download, transmit or save the 'raw' data (tiles) from the Services under any circumstances.
- (e) Use Prints of type "Ordnance Survey Map" as described in the SDK's.
- (f) Use Prints to create production maps which are similar to or compete with commercial maps or atlases.
- (g) Use the Services to produce Prints similar to a local mapping authority.
- (h) Alter a screen shot in any way except to resize the screen shot.
